The Garrett Family Manuscript Collection (MSS 002) consists of local deeds and estate papers dating back as early as 1772. Some of the deeds are on vellum or oversized and fragile. A few family papers can be found in this collection as well; there is a poem for Sarah Garrett written by her father in 1834, and the Maris Garrett journal from 1864 includes daily entries, mostly weather reports and some family news.
This collection is rich in artifacts and photographs. Additionally, a few artifacts from Warren Garret, including a pendant from a local masonic lodge, Thompson Lodge no. 340 from 1907. Family bibles from the Garrett and Lewis families containing family history and notes, can be found in this collection as well.Context
